Mary Thompson, Capstone President, was recently quoted in this Reuters article. The article highlights changes with insurance coverage’s in the entertainment industry following the unexpected death of Pop Icon Michael Jackson prior to his “This Is It” tour. Pop Stars such as Britney Spears may experience higher insurance rates as a result. Currently promoters pay 3-5% of the value of a policy for an event in case of cancellation or postponement. Mary Thompson, president of Las Vegas-based Capstone Brokerage, said she expects Spears probably bought “contingency insurance” for her Planet Hollywood residency but now it includes new stipulations following the pop star’s widely publicized breakdown a few years go.
